SPERMICIDAL SPONGE ON DRUG STORE SHELVES

There's a new birth control device on the Canadian market, called Protectaid. The vaginal sponge is made of polyurethane foam containing a combination of three spermicides. The product was developed by Axcan Ltd. of Mont. St-Hallaire, Que. The sponge is also being tested to determine if it prevents sexually transmitted diseases. Axcan began seminars this week to promote Protectaid to health care professionals, as well as a public relations push aimed at consumers. PR is being done by NATIONAL Pharmacom of Toronto. Axcan is not advertising the product.
